What is Injectable Weight Loss?
Defining Injectable Weight Loss
Injectable weight loss refers to the use of prescribed medications administered through injections to assist individuals in losing weight. This method specifically targets those who struggle with obesity or overweight challenges, incorporating lifestyle changes such as diet and exercise into the treatment plan. These pharmaceuticals often mimic natural hormones in the body that regulate appetite and metabolism, resulting in reduced hunger and increased feelings of fullness.
How Injectable Weight Loss Works
Injectable weight loss medications primarily function as appetite suppressants or metabolic enhancers. They alter how the body processes food, leading to weight loss by decreasing appetite or increasing feelings of satiety. For instance, many use gl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ptor agonists which help in weight management by duplicating certain hormones that make individuals feel fuller faster. Types of Injectable Weight Loss Treatments
GLP-1 Receptor Agonists
GLP-1 receptor agonists represent a popular class of injectable weight loss medications. These injections work by mimicking the effects of the GLP-1 hormone, which regulates appetite and insulin release. It is known for its ability to help individuals lose weight efficiently by making them feel full earlier during meals. This class includes medications such as semaglutide, which has been critically acclaimed for its efficacy in weight management.

Potential Side Effects and Considerations
Common Side Effects
As with any medication, injectable weight loss treatments come with potential side effects. Commonly reported issues may include nausea, diarrhea, and abdominal pain, especially when initiating the treatment. These side effects are generally mild and tend to decrease over time as the body acclimates to the medication. Patients should maintain open communication with their healthcare providers to manage any adverse reactions effectively.
